Council preview covers small-gift acceptance policy and $20,000 settlement with Cave Enterprises

Duluth City Council (agenda session) · January 22, 2026

Summary

At the agenda session councilors discussed a proposed resolution letting the city administrator accept monetary gifts up to $10,000 (grants excluded) and were briefed on a proposed $20,000 settlement payment from Cave Enterprises; councilors asked about oversight and reporting on small gifts.

The council’s agenda preview included a pair of consent items that drew specific questions: a proposed resolution to let the city administrator accept monetary gifts of $10,000 or less on the city’s behalf, and a proposed settlement (Resolution 70) in which Cave Enterprises Operations LLC would pay the city $20,000 under the terms of a settlement agreement.
